Life affirming rather than gloomy, obituaries have been a staple of The Times since the mid 19th century, a “first draft of history” record of the great, the good and sometimes the bad. In an age of quickfire news, our readers continue to enjoy their satisfying beginning-middle-and-end narrative arcs, which is why many still turn to them first. Far from being solemn or obsequious, our obits are peppered with colourful anecdotes and illuminating personal details. Sometimes irreverent, often insightful, they always aim to weave a spell and tell a story.
